Origin of State Name: Named for Admiral William Penn, father of the founder of Pennsylvania.
Nickname: The Keystone State.
Capital: Harrisburg.
County: 67 counties
Location: 40.276N, 76.884W
Entered Union: 12 December 1787 (2nd).
Song: "Pennsylvania."
Motto: Virtue, Liberty and Independence.
Flag: The coat of arms appears in the center of a blue field.
Animal: White-tailed deer.
Bird: Ruffed grouse.
Dog: Great Dane.
Fish: Brook trout.
Insect: Firefly.
Flower: Mountain laurel.
Tree: Hemlock.
Beautification and Conservation Plant: Penngift crownvetch.
Beverage: Milk.
Fossil: Phacops rana.
Population: 12,429,616 as on 2005 census
Agriculture: Dairy products, poultry, cattle, nursery stock, mushrooms, hogs, hay.
Industry: Food processing, chemical products, machinery, electric equipment, tourism.
